Read the following Assertion and Reason and choose the correct option. Assertion: Cleistogamous flowers are invariably autogamous as there is no chance of cross-pollen landing on the stigma Reason: When anthers dehisce in the flower buds, pollen grains come in contact with the stigma to effect pollination
Options
- ABoth Assertion and Reason are true and Reason is correct explanation of Assertion
- BBoth Assertion and Reason are true but the Reason is not the correct explanation of Assertion
- CAssertion is true but the Reason is false
- DBoth Assertion and Reason are false
Correct answer
A. Both Assertion and Reason are true and Reason is correct explanation of Assertion
Step-by-step solution
Cleistogamous flowers are invariably autogamous as there is no chance of cross-pollen landing on the stigma. When anthers dehisce in the flower buds, pollen grains come in contact with the stigma to effect pollination
